Mudlarks – Cooks River Bird Survey – 11 November 2025

I took part in the Bird Survey along the Cooks River with the Mudlarks. This month the survey was the upstream loop – to the Boat Harbour and Cup and Saucer Creek Wetlands.

We saw a good range of birds, including quite a few baby birds.
